스프링 프레임워크는 지속적인 성장과 발전을 거듭하며 새로운 기능과 개선 사항을 지속적으로 반영하고 있습니다. 특히 스프링 Web Flow 역시 버전이 업데이트됨에 따라 새로운 기능과 버그 수정이 계속해서 추가되고 있습니다. 따라서 개발자들은 스프링 Web Flow를 정상적으로 사용하기 위해 버전 관리 전략을 정확히 이해하고 있어야 합니다.
최신 버전 사용의 장점
새로운 버전을 사용하는 것은 다양한 이점을 제공합니다. 가장 큰 장점은 기능의 개선입니다. 새로운 버전은 이전 버전보다 더 많은 기능을 제공하며, 이를 통해 애플리케이션의 성능과 사용자 경험을 향상시킬 수 있습니다.
또한, 새로운 버전은 이전 버전에서 발견된 버그의 수정을 포함하고 있습니다. 따라서 새로운 버전을 사용함으로써 소프트웨어의 안정성을 향상시킬 수 있습니다.
마지막으로, 보안 이슈의 대응은 매우 중요합니다. 새로운 버전은 이전 버전에서 발견된 보안 취약점에 대한 해결책을 제공하기 때문에, 보다 안전한 애플리케이션을 유지할 수 있습니다.
버전 업그레이드의 고려 사항
새로운 버전을 적용하기 위해서는 몇 가지 고려 사항이 있습니다. 가장 중요한 것은 호환성 문제입니다. 새로운 버전이 기존 코드나 의존성에 영향을 미칠 수 있기 때문에 이에 대한 충분한 테스트와 검증이 필요합니다.
또한, 문서 및 커뮤니티 지원을 고려해야 합니다. 새로운 버전의 문서가 충분하고, 커뮤니티에서 활발한 지원을 제공하는지 확인하는 것이 중요합니다. 새로운 버전에 대한 보안 패치 및 업데이트가 빠르게 제공되는지에 대한 확인도 필요합니다.
결론
스프링 Web Flow의 최신 버전을 사용하는 것은 애플리케이션의 안정성과 보안성을 유지하고, 성능을 향상시킬 수 있는 방법입니다. 새로운 버전을 적용할 때에는 충분한 테스트와 검증을 거쳐야 하며, 문서와 커뮤니티의 지원을 충분히 고려해야 합니다. 올바른 버전 관리 전략을 통해 안정적이고 성능이 우수한 애플리케이션을 유지할 수 있을 것입니다.
다양한 스프링 Web Flow의 사용 사례와 버전 관리 전략에 대한 정보는 스프링 공식 웹사이트나 개발자 커뮤니티에서 찾아볼 수 있습니다.